Steps to reproduce:

A recent update of FF has restored numerous areas of white space bacgrounds on web pages. I must have a full black background with no white space while using high contrast mode. Please fix this!

You can enter about:config into the address bar and set browser.display.permit_backplate to false. Bug 1617681 aims to add the setting to about:preferences.

Firefox 75 will have some improvements, like bug 1614921 and bug 1617678. There's still bug 1616440 for other cases.
